On Oct. 4, 2017 officers with the Sault Ste. Marie Police Service’s Break and Enter Unit arrested 20-year-old Christian Tucci of Wellington Street East for theft and possession of stolen property.

It is alleged that on Aug. 16, 2017 the accused stole a wallet from a parked vehicle and used a bank card to make just under $130 in purchases. 

Later, on Sept. 20, 2017 the accused again took a wallet from a parked motor vehicle. The accused then again used the victim’s bank card to make purchases.

Officers located the accused on Oct. 4 and he was taken into custody. Upon his arrest the accused was found to be in possession of a small amount of heroin and methamphetamine. 

He has been charged 2 counts of theft under $5,000, 2 counts of possession of property obtained by crime and 2 counts of possession of a controlled substance. He will appear in court on Nov. 20, 2017.
